This dress reminds me of vanilla ice cream on a hot day... fashioned from the most delicious broderie anglaise, this classic 1950s dress has a feast of features: sweet Peter Pan collar, short sleeves with turned back cuffs, metal side zip and a full, swishy skirt. The bodice has a top layer of broderie anglaise and then a more opaque fabric underneath from the bust down. The skirt has the same two layers of fabric, and finishes in a beautifully scalloped hem.
